Loved this movie so much when it came out! The effects were amazing. It wasn't just your standard "animation over live-action" movie, which had been done many times before. For the first time, these animated characters had actual depth; they seemed to inhabit the live-action scenes instead of floating over it. It was also the first time in a long time a widely released U.S. animated movie was targeted toward a more mature audience.
